using System;
using System.Drawing;
using System.Drawing.Drawing2D;
using System.Drawing.Imaging;
using System.IO;
namespace ImageDrawing


{

/**//// <summary>
/// 图片修改类,主要是用来保护图片版权的
/// </summary>
public class ImageModification

{

"member fields"#region "member fields"
private string modifyImagePath=null;
private string drawedImagePath=null;
private int rightSpace;
private int bottoamSpace;
private int lucencyPercent=70;
private string outPath=null;
#endregion
public ImageModification()

{
}

"propertys"#region "propertys"

/**//// <summary>
/// 获取或设置要修改的图像路径
/// </summary>
public string ModifyImagePath

{

get
{return this.modifyImagePath;}

set
{this.modifyImagePath=value;}
}

/**//// <summary>
/// 获取或设置在画的图片路径(水印图片)
/// </summary>
public string DrawedImagePath

{

get
{return this.drawedImagePath;}

set
{this.drawedImagePath=value;}
}

/**//// <summary>
/// 获取或设置水印在修改图片中的右边距
/// </summary>
public int RightSpace

{

get
{return this.rightSpace;}

set
{this.rightSpace=value;}
}
//获取或设置水印在修改图片中距底部的高度
public int BottoamSpace

{

get
{return this.bottoamSpace;}

set
{this.bottoamSpace=value;}
}

/**//// <summary>
/// 获取或设置要绘制水印的透明度,注意是原来图片透明度的百分比
/// </summary>
public int LucencyPercent

{

get
{return this.lucencyPercent;}
set

{
if(value>=0&&value<=100)
this.lucencyPercent=value;
}
}

/**//// <summary>
/// 获取或设置要输出图像的路径
/// </summary>
public string OutPath

{

get
{return this.outPath;}

set
{this.outPath=value;}
}
#endregion

"methods"#region "methods"

/**//// <summary>
/// 开始绘制水印
/// </summary>
public void DrawImage()

{
Image modifyImage=null;
Image drawedImage=null;
Graphics g=null;
try

{
//建立图形对象
modifyImage=Image.FromFile(this.ModifyImagePath);
drawedImage=Image.FromFile(this.DrawedImagePath);
g=Graphics.FromImage(modifyImage);
//获取要绘制图形坐标
int x=modifyImage.Width-this.rightSpace;
int y=modifyImage.Height-this.BottoamSpace;
//设置颜色矩阵

float[][] matrixItems =
{

new float[]
{1, 0, 0, 0, 0},

new float[]
{0, 1, 0, 0, 0},

new float[]
{0, 0, 1, 0, 0},

new float[]
{0, 0, 0, (float)this.LucencyPercent/100f, 0},

new float[]
{0, 0, 0, 0, 1}};

ColorMatrix colorMatrix = new ColorMatrix(matrixItems);
ImageAttributes imgAttr=new ImageAttributes();
imgAttr.SetColorMatrix(colorMatrix,ColorMatrixFlag.Default,ColorAdjustType.Bitmap);
//绘制阴影图像
g.DrawImage(
drawedImage,
new Rectangle(x,y,drawedImage.Width,drawedImage.Height),
0,0,drawedImage.Width,drawedImage.Height,
GraphicsUnit.Pixel,imgAttr);
//保存文件

string[] allowImageType=
{".jpg",".gif",".png",".bmp",".tiff",".wmf",".ico"};
FileInfo file=new FileInfo(this.ModifyImagePath);
ImageFormat imageType=ImageFormat.Gif;
switch(file.Extension.ToLower())

{
case ".jpg":
imageType=ImageFormat.Jpeg;
break;
case ".gif":
imageType=ImageFormat.Gif;
break;
case ".png":
imageType=ImageFormat.Png;
break;
case ".bmp":
imageType=ImageFormat.Bmp;
break;
case ".tif":
imageType=ImageFormat.Tiff;
break;
case ".wmf":
imageType=ImageFormat.Wmf;
break;
case ".ico":
imageType=ImageFormat.Icon;
break;
default:
break;
}
MemoryStream ms=new MemoryStream();
modifyImage.Save(ms,imageType);
byte[] imgData=ms.ToArray();
modifyImage.Dispose();
drawedImage.Dispose();
g.Dispose();
FileStream fs=null;
if(this.OutPath==null || this.OutPath=="")

{
File.Delete(this.ModifyImagePath);
fs=new FileStream(this.ModifyImagePath,FileMode.Create,FileAccess.Write);
}
else

{
fs=new FileStream(this.OutPath,FileMode.Create,FileAccess.Write);
}
if(fs!=null)

{
fs.Write(imgData,0,imgData.Length);
fs.Close();
}
}
finally

{
try

{
drawedImage.Dispose();
modifyImage.Dispose();
g.Dispose();
}

catch
{;}
}
}
#endregion
}
}
